Overview of Hillmorton High School

Hillmorton High School, located in the heart of Christchurch, New Zealand, stands as a vibrant and inclusive learning community that fosters academic excellence, cultural respect, and personal development. As a co-educational school in New Zealand, it welcomes students from Years 7 to 13, providing a unique composite school experience that bridges the gap between intermediate and senior education.

A proud member of the Kāhui Ako (Community of Learning), Hillmorton High School emphasizes student-centred learning, diversity, and innovation. With a focus on restorative practices, positive relationships, and strong leadership, the school has become a beacon of educational excellence within the New Zealand secondary schools landscape.

Education Levels and Curriculum

Hillmorton High School offers a seamless Year 7–13 education model, nurturing students through their most formative academic years. The intermediate and senior school structure allows for age-appropriate teaching, enhanced continuity, and personalized learning journeys.

The school follows the New Zealand Curriculum, ensuring students gain critical skills, knowledge, and values. It delivers the National Certificate of Educational Achievement (NCEA) framework, preparing learners for tertiary education, vocational training, or the workforce. With curriculum differentiation and literacy and numeracy progress tracking, every student receives the tools to achieve their full potential.

Welcome to Hamilton Girls’ High School

Nestled in the heart of the Waikato Region, Hamilton Girls’ High School (HGHS) is more than just an educational institution—it’s a launchpad for future leaders, innovators, and change-makers. For over a century, HGHS has delivered a nurturing, empowering environment designed exclusively for young women to thrive academically, socially, and personally.

Located in Hamilton City, one of New Zealand’s most vibrant urban centers, HGHS is a beacon for all-girls education. Its longstanding commitment to excellence, diversity, and inclusivity makes it a top choice for both domestic and international students seeking a high-quality, future-focused education.
